Preguntas frecuentes sobre Foy

¿Cuál es el precio y la disponibilidad actual de los apartamentos en alquiler en Foy, CA?

A día de hoy, 07 de Agosto, 2026, hay 5,690 apartamentos disponibles en Foy con precios desde $600 hasta $43,550 y un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,935.

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Foy?

Actualmente hay 3,131 Apartamentos Estudios en Foy con alquileres que van desde $699 hasta $4,568, con un precio medio de $2,028.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Foy?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Foy varian entre $600 y $8,425 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,595

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Foy?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Foy van desde $1,004 hasta $39,303.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,626

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Foy?

En estos momentos hay 712 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Foy en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,050 y $43,550 - con una media de $6,604 para el lugar.
